For the boss, upgrade shot power and battery charger. Upgrade anything else to help you get there. When fighting the boss shoot the bricks half at a time to avoid the skulls. Save up charge a little bit more than the ball then let launch the ball to hopefully hit the two colors in the back. Keep doing this until the boss has eaten 3 blue and orange balls to win.

To defeat Tesla, be sure to have Charger +2 (at least) upgraded. Just shoot some skulls he summons till ya can summon ball. Make ball hit those two relays next to Tesla, and after next wave of skulls you shoot, he'll eat that charged ball. Repeat two more times, and it's the end. Don't let skulls pass, as it's the end as well.
